EU DESIGN RADIO -- Joshua Singer, assistant professor of Design and Industry, is looking at data differently. His “Different Data” project, with several collaborators, explores the city of Detroit by examining and experimenting with visual language, methodology and various approaches to generating and collecting data.

While at the Cumulus Milan conference in June, Singer and colleague Rachele Riley discussed “Different Data” in an interview with EU Design Radio.

“As designers and design researchers, we come in, and in these irreverent ways, bring in data around issues that concern us,” Singer says, “and then display them in a very, sort of improvisatory manner, in a way that tries to challenge some of the existing views, and in a way that creates a different view of reality.”
